DESCRIPTION
Michael Baker International is seeking a Senior Fire Protection Engineering Consultant to join our team. The Fire Protection Engineer will be a ‘Doer/Seller’ in the New England region as a client manager. They will be responsible for project delivery, client satisfaction, and they will be supported by the full MBI fire protection engineering team.
Projects and clients include all aspects of fire protection engineering design from ‘cradle to grave’. This includes the responsibilities of proposal preparation, complete system design, site evaluations, and testing and commissioning of systems. Typical projects and types of systems include fire sprinklers, fire pumps, high expansion foam, clean agent systems, fire alarm and mass notification systems. Industries include Department of Defense (DoD), Data Centers, Industrial and Manufacturing, and commercial clients.
Primary Responsibilities:
- Business development and client management
- Be responsible for proposal preparation, project budgets and project work schedules
- Perform hydraulic calculations for sprinkler and fire pump design
- Analyze life safety requirements for buildings, including building code compliance, occupant load calculations and egress analysis
- Perform on-site system evaluations and perform final system testing
- Coordinate designs with other engineering disciplines
Business Development:
- Grow revenue from existing client base through ensuring high quality work product and regular client interactions.
- Attend local industry events to create and maintain networking connections.
- Identify and win new work from new and existing clients.
Client Management:
- Communicate with clients to understand their needs and provide technical expertise.
- Present project proposals and updates to clients.
- Ensure client satisfaction through effective project delivery.
Required Qualifications:
- Registered Professional Engineer in Fire Protection
- 10+ years professional experience
- BS or MS in Fire Protection Engineering or related field
- Experience in fire protection system design including: fire sprinkler systems, fire pumps, clean agent systems, high expansion foam systems, fire alarm and mass notification systems
- Experience in computer generated hydraulic design
- Knowledge and experience of building and design codes, specifically IBC, NFPA 101, NFPA 13 and NFPA 72

Understand how PERM timing affects Green Card planning
For EB-2 or EB-3 sponsorship, your employer files a PERM labor certification with DOL before submitting the immigrant petition. At a consulting firm like Michael Baker, this process typically begins after you've established tenure in your role, so ask about their internal policy during the offer negotiation.
Prepare a project portfolio that documents specialty occupation
USCIS requires H-1B petitions to demonstrate the role requires at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field. A portfolio of engineering deliverables, such as design calculations, technical reports, or CAD documentation, directly supports your employer's petition by showing the role demands specialized knowledge.

How do I plan around H-1B lottery timing for a Development Engineer offer?
If you receive an offer and need H-1B sponsorship, USCIS opens H-1B registration in March each year for an October 1 start date. If your OPT expires before October 1 and you're selected in the lottery, a cap-gap extension automatically covers the period between OPT expiration and your H-1B start date. Coordinating your offer acceptance and start date around this window is one of the first practical conversations to have with Michael Baker's HR team.
